Sector Insight: Industrial Gas Suppliers
The Industrial Gas Suppliers sector reported 569K metric tons of CO2-equivalent emissions across 5 facilities operated by 3 distinct companies in the most recent EPA Greenhouse Gas Reporting Program (GHGRP) reporting year. On a per-facility basis, this averages approximately 114K metric tons of CO2e per year, a measure of emissions intensity that reflects the typical scale of operations required to cross the 25,000 MT CO2e annual reporting threshold that triggers mandatory GHGRP disclosure under 40 CFR Part 98.

Comparing Industrial Gas Suppliers against other EPA-classified sectors requires care. Industry classifications in GHGRP aggregate facilities by primary activity, so a vertically integrated company may have facilities reported in several sectors. The figures shown here represent only Scope 1 direct emissions, combustion, process, and fugitive sources at reporting facilities. Scope 2 electricity purchases and Scope 3 value-chain emissions are excluded.
